“Shirley Shackleton was launched into an unexpected life as a human rights activist when her journalist husband Greg Shackleton was killed in East Timor in 1975.” This is the introduction to Shirley Shackleton’s autobiographical account of her life titled ‘The Circle of Silence’ published this year.

‘A compelling personal insight into a defining time in our history. Shirley Shackleton’s courage is inspiring’Robert Connolly, Director, Balibo

‘The Circle of Silence’ provides a profoundly disturbing insight into the kind of Australia we actually live in and Shirley Shackleton’s story is moving and inspiring for her tenacity and courage in the face of terrible odds and very powerful enemies in the form of Australian leaders, who clearly do not share the values held dear by most Australians who voted them into power.

A unique glimpse of a young teenager (Armindo), telling his story in song – accompanying himself on a beautiful little home made ukelele.  Recorded  by the documentary-maker 7 months after the Suai Church Massacre on the verandah of a house rehabilitated for the use of Timor Aid.

The following slideshow contains eleven paintings of landscapes from the bright and lush representations of ‘Collection of Flowers to the most bleak in ‘Untitled’ ‘Think about the Future’and ‘Boat of Life’.

Perhaps the most interesting are ‘East Timor‘ and ‘Habelun ho Lafaek‘ that provide interesting global and mythological perspectives on the island of East Timor. (see cultural notes on crocodile myth) Once again we find women in the landscape and just one man who could be Xanana in ‘Director Liberty’ overlooking a devastated landscape covered with bodies and guns while a young man holds up the Timorese flag.
